i dont remember what wires i cut and connected, but i bypassed the tip over sensor on the main harness under the seat. so now the only wires i have up front is for the low beam. but i have that tucked and ziptied to the cross bar behing the neck of the frame. you cant see a thing. the only wires you see are from the ignition. if you dont want to trim down your entire harness then run the connectors for your tach and lights through the small space between the radiator (the two brackets on top of the radiator) and neck of your frame. it moves the wires from the side of your frame for a cleaner look.
